This is a localized term for the synthesizer or electronic keyboard. The "Yonika" style of Kuchek is defined by fast-fingered, improvisational synth solos that mimic traditional wind instruments.

This often refers to a "deep" or "heavy" sound. In traditional Bulgarian music, "Kaba" is associated with the large, deep-toned bagpipes ( Kaba Gaida ), but in the modern remix context, it signals heavy bass and a "fat" synthesizer sound.
